Transaction 43257d913e725dfce22082671b128375a96522616b792177163d9f90fc6451ce

23 Input
2 Outputs
  • 43257d913e725dfce22082671b128375a96522616b792177163d9f90fc6451ce:0
  • value  652323
    address  1MxWTWhJKAsoajjDeR1A5hhi9XCDMTKCna
  • 43257d913e725dfce22082671b128375a96522616b792177163d9f90fc6451ce:1
  • value  246213262
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s